3. Port numbers (SMTP, IMAP, POP3)
Configuration of electronic mail clients for use with Atlantic Broadband’s services necessitates a clear understanding of port numbers associated with the Simple Mail Transfer Protocol (SMTP), Internet Message Access Protocol (IMAP), and Post Office Protocol version 3 (POP3). These numbers define the communication endpoints for email transmission and retrieval, ensuring proper routing of data between the client and the mail servers.
-
SMTP and Outgoing Mail Transmission
SMTP is the standard protocol for sending email. The common port numbers associated with SMTP are 25 (unsecured), 587 (submission port, often with TLS/STARTTLS), and 465 (deprecated for direct SSL, but potentially still in use). Atlantic Broadband’s email service typically mandates the use of port 587 with TLS/STARTTLS for secure outgoing mail transmission. Using an incorrect SMTP port can result in failed email delivery due to connection refusal or security protocol mismatch. For instance, if the client is configured to use port 25 without encryption, and Atlantic Broadband requires TLS, the email will not be sent.
-
IMAP and Mail Access
IMAP allows email clients to access and manage email directly on the server. The standard port number for IMAP is 143 (unsecured), while the secure port for IMAP with SSL/TLS is 993. Correct IMAP port configuration is crucial for reading, organizing, and managing emails residing on Atlantic Broadband’s mail servers. If the client is configured to use port 143 without encryption when Atlantic Broadband requires a secure connection, the connection will fail, preventing access to email.
-
POP3 and Mail Retrieval
POP3 is a protocol used to download email from the server to the client. The default port number for POP3 is 110 (unsecured), and the secure port for POP3 with SSL/TLS is 995. When configuring an email client to retrieve messages from Atlantic Broadband using POP3, specifying the correct port is vital. Failure to use the correct port, especially if a secure connection is required (port 995), will result in the inability to download emails and potential security risks if unencrypted communication is attempted.
-
Security Considerations
The selection of port numbers is intrinsically linked to security considerations. Utilizing secure ports (465, 587, 993, 995) with the appropriate encryption (SSL/TLS) is paramount for protecting sensitive email data during transmission. Configuring email clients to use unsecured ports poses a significant security risk, as email content and credentials can be intercepted. Atlantic Broadband’s recommended security settings should be strictly adhered to, including the use of secure ports, to mitigate potential security vulnerabilities.

The practical implementation of password encryption within atlanticbb net email settings typically involves employing hashing algorithms, often combined with salting. Hashing transforms the password into a fixed-size string of characters, while salting adds a unique, random value to each password before hashing. This prevents attackers from using pre-computed tables (rainbow tables) to reverse the hashing process and recover the original passwords. The choice of hashing algorithm and salt generation method is critical. Outdated or weak algorithms can be susceptible to brute-force attacks or other cryptanalytic techniques. Frequently Asked Questions Regarding Atlanticbb Net Email Settings
The following section addresses common inquiries and clarifies essential information pertaining to the proper configuration of electronic mail services when utilizing Atlantic Broadband (atlanticbb.net).
Question 1: What is the correct incoming server address for atlanticbb.net email?
The incoming server address is typically “mail.atlanticbb.net.” Ensure the email client is configured to use this address for retrieving incoming messages.
Question 2: What is the correct outgoing server address (SMTP) for atlanticbb.net email?
The outgoing server address is typically “smtp.atlanticbb.net.” Configuration of the email client to use this address is essential for sending email messages.
Question 3: What port numbers should be used for secure email access with atlanticbb.net?
For secure IMAP access, use port 993 with SSL/TLS. For secure POP3 access, use port 995 with SSL/TLS. For secure SMTP, use port 587 with TLS/STARTTLS.
Question 4: Does atlanticbb.net require SSL/TLS encryption for email communication?
Yes, Atlantic Broadband mandates the use of SSL/TLS encryption to protect the confidentiality and integrity of email communications. Configuration without encryption is strongly discouraged.
Question 5: What username format is required for atlanticbb.net email accounts?
The username format is typically the full email address (e.g., username@atlanticbb.net). Using an abbreviated username will result in authentication failure.
Question 6: What should be done if encountering persistent issues with atlanticbb.net email configuration?
Verify all settings against the official Atlantic Broadband documentation or contact their technical support for assistance. Ensure the email client is compatible with the required security protocols and authentication methods.

Configuration Insights
This section offers actionable insights to ensure proper configuration of electronic mail services, focusing on atlanticbb net email settings. Adherence to these recommendations will mitigate potential issues and optimize performance.
Tip 1: Verify Server Addresses. Accuracy is paramount. The incoming server address, typically mail.atlanticbb.net, and the outgoing server address, smtp.atlanticbb.net, must be entered precisely. Typographical errors will prevent successful connection.
Tip 2: Employ Secure Port Numbers. Default port numbers are often insecure. Always utilize secure ports: 993 for IMAP with SSL/TLS, 995 for POP3 with SSL/TLS, and 587 for SMTP with TLS/STARTTLS. Failing to do so exposes data to interception.
Tip 3: Enable SSL/TLS Encryption. Ensure that the email client is configured to use SSL/TLS encryption for both incoming and outgoing mail. This encrypts the communication channel, safeguarding sensitive information.
Tip 4: Use the Full Email Address as Username. The atlanticbb net email system typically requires the full email address (e.g., user@atlanticbb.net) as the username. Abbreviated usernames will result in authentication failure.
Tip 5: Regularly Update the Email Client. Outdated email clients may lack support for modern security protocols and encryption standards. Keeping the email client updated ensures compatibility and enhances security.
Tip 6: Review Authentication Settings. Confirm that the email client is configured to use the correct authentication method. Typically, this involves password-based authentication, but multi-factor authentication may be available.
Tip 7: Consult Official Documentation. When in doubt, refer to the official Atlantic Broadband documentation or contact their technical support for accurate configuration instructions. Avoid relying on unofficial or outdated sources.
